From mayo clinic online: The most common way to become infected with giardia is after swallowing contaminated water. Giardia parasites are found in lakes, ponds, rivers and streams worldwide, as well as in municipal water supplies, wells, cisterns, swimming pools, water parks and spas. Ground and surface water can become contaminated from agricultural runoff, wastewater discharge or animal feces. Children in diapers and people with diarrhea may accidentally contaminate pools and spas. Giardia parasites can be transmitted through food - either because food handlers with giardiasis don't wash their hands thoroughly or because raw produce is irrigated or washed with contaminated water. Because cooking food kills giardia, food is a less common source of infection than water is, especially in industrialized countries. You can contract giardiasis if your hands become contaminated with fecal matter - parents changing a child's diapers are especially at risk. So are child care workers and children in child care centers, where outbreaks are increasingly common. The giardia parasite can also spread through anal sex.

Better than average, and I'm glad you found the article about Dr. Peterson. However, there are some flaws in your presentation that mostly resolve around one little known factor. While the vast majority of cats with a high T4 have an almost always benign tumor (which is what forces the overproduction), it is possible for the T4 and Free T4 to be slightly high without a tumor. Most vets still think this is impossible, but Dr. Peterson documented such non-thyroid spikes back around 2016. There is no direct connection between food/iodine intake and developing a tumor, but food may play a factor in the non-thyroid spikes. (And soy may be bigger in that than iodine.) When a diagnosis is borderline, it becomes critical to determine if there is a tumor since it can affect treatment options. (Doing the 131 if there is no tumor would destroy the healthy thyroid tissue.) If you have a cat who is being sick on a regular basis while being given carbizamole / similar, it is because he / she is allergic to it. Transdermal medicine will almost certainly work very well in this situation - all you need to do is find a pharmacist to provide the medication and if you live in a part of the world where it is not readily available, a pharmacist can easily make it from crushed-up tablets. My cat nearly died from carbizamole tablets but transdermal medication really works.

Here's what I was charged yesterday for my cat's diagnosis: Examination-$48 CompPlus Panel-$79.73 CBC-$46.98 Total T4-$52.62 Methimazole 5mg (thyroid pills)-$18.16 Clavamox Drops (infection meds for liver)-$59.43 Total:$304.92 I go to a veterinarian in Florence, SC so the prices of course won't be the same but this will give you an idea. They first drew some blood for testing which took that machine about 15mins to do and they did an ultrasound on him while the blood was being tested. The ultrasound detected an infection he had in his liver due to the high levels of T4. The blood work easily showed that his thyroid levels were not normal and so she went ahead and put him on a 1/2 pill a day of methimazole and has us coming back to see her on October 7th for another blood test to check his T4 levels again. I asked her how long would it be before I start seeing improvements and she said in 2wks. Today is the 2nd day on the pills and he's already getting his appetite back. The whole process was easy so I don't understand why they're making it difficult on you and your baby. Take a screen shot of this and take it to another vet and tell them you want his T4 checked and a ultrasound done. If his T4 is a 5 or higher, then he has hyperthyroidism. A 2.5-4 is normal and anything below 2.5 would be hypothyroidism but that's rare in cats. I hope you can find a good doctor that will give him the right help he needs.
